QML is an xml styling format used by QGIS. A QML file can be imported into the Tygron Platform as Legend Entries of a Grid Overlay.
Notes
- Styling QML of a WMS in QGIS often cannot be imported, as the legend of a WMS is provided as a style image and not individual entries.
